Output 1ddc8d6b06db956ae9ed7b8eb37d65d50472438812cda67c43fda5f468339152:14

value
526
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e64209e4aa3fd7bef571ca39cb6f2cfb5297904720cb17df06ba993e051772f7
address
bc1puepqne928ltmaat3eguukmevldff0yz8yr930hcxh2vnupghwtms8ee6nj
transaction
1ddc8d6b06db956ae9ed7b8eb37d65d50472438812cda67c43fda5f468339152
confirmations
30263
spent
true